Frequently Asked Questions

How popular is the name Kailei?
Kailei has been given to 617 babies in the U.S. since 1988, according to SSA data. Among girls, it ranks #12586 as of the latest data. 34 babies were born in 2004, its single highest year.
When was Kailei most popular?
Kailei was most popular in the 2000s decade with 282 total births. The single peak year was 2004.
Where is Kailei most popular?
The top states for the name Kailei are Texas (19 births), California (18 births), Georgia (5 births).
How long has the name Kailei been used?
The SSA has tracked Kailei since 1988 -- 37 years through the most recent 2024 data.
